Output 0653592c56c31ce153c7fc67e3577f583309a5900b329aae659a72ea7c45b67e:1

value
17769819
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95bd7f0fc3aaed5f51ff00204b4e45cfdddab2c9 OP_EQUALVERIFY OP_CHECKSIG
address
1Eekh26THjkezsxFxjaPsaZQDieLo1rqe5
transaction
0653592c56c31ce153c7fc67e3577f583309a5900b329aae659a72ea7c45b67e
spent
true